Choose the Right Space
The first step in hosting a cozy movie night is selecting the ideal spot in your home. This might be your living room, a finished basement, or even a bedroom with a TV or projector. Consider the following factors:
– Comfort: Make sure there is enough seating for everyone. Soft couches, armchairs, floor cushions, and blankets can add to the cozy vibe.
– Lighting: Dim or turn off the main lights and use lamps, string lights, or candles to create a warm ambiance.
– Sound: Ensure your audio setup is clear but not too loud to maintain a pleasant environment.
Set Up Your Viewing Equipment
Once you have your space ready, focus on your viewing setup.
– Screen Options: Use a TV, projector, or even a laptop depending on your available gear. Projectors offer a larger screen experience that can feel like a mini theater.
– Audio Quality: If possible, use external speakers or a soundbar to improve sound. Wireless headphones can be a good choice for smaller groups or late-night viewing.
– Streaming or DVDs: Plan your movie selection ahead of time and ensure your chosen device and apps are ready and tested to avoid interruptions.

Plan Your Movie Selection
Picking the right movies can make or break the night.
– Consider Your Audience: Choose films that fit the tastes and age ranges of your guests.
– Mix Genres: A variety of genres can keep things interesting, such as a comedy followed by a classic or a family-friendly animation.
– Have Options: Prepare a shortlist and let the group vote to keep everyone involved.
Prepare Tasty Snacks and Drinks
No movie night is complete without snacks and drinks.
Snack Ideas
– Popcorn: A classic choice, season it with butter, cheese, or spices for variety.
– Finger Foods: Cheese and crackers, veggie sticks with dip, mini sandwiches, or nachos work well.
– Sweet Treats: Cookies, brownies, or candy add a fun touch.
Drink Options
– Non-Alcoholic: Soda, sparkling water, or homemade lemonade.
– Hot Drinks: Tea, hot chocolate, or coffee, especially in cooler weather.
– Alcoholic: Wine, beer, or cocktails, if appropriate for your group.
